The first public molecular recognition database, BindingDB supports research, education and practice in drug discovery, pharmacology and related fields.

BindingDB contains 3.2M data for 1.4M Compounds and 11.4K Targets. Of those, 1.6M data for 748K Compounds and 4.8K Targets were curated by BindingDB curators. BindingDB is a FAIRsharing resource.
